Things to Buy in Lao Chai Village Market

Last updated: July 2026 — Written and reviewed by the Sapa Pathfinder Travel local guide team

Lao Chai’s small village market and roadside stalls sell handwoven indigo textiles, embroidered items, silver jewelry, and woven baskets, mostly made by local Black Hmong artisans. Prices are generally negotiable, and buying directly supports village families more than purchases made in Sapa town’s larger tourist shops.

What to Buy in Lao Chai

  • Indigo-dyed textiles — scarves, fabric lengths, and clothing dyed using traditional methods.
  • Hand embroidery — decorative panels, bags, and clothing accents with intricate stitched patterns.
  • Silver jewelry — bracelets, necklaces, and earrings crafted by local artisans.
  • Woven baskets — practical handwoven items used in daily village life.
  • Hemp products — items made from locally grown and processed hemp fiber.

Tips for Shopping in Lao Chai

  • Bargaining is expected but should be done respectfully — a friendly back-and-forth, not aggressive haggling.
  • Bring small bills, as change for large notes can be limited.
  • Ask about the making process — many artisans are happy to explain how a piece was made, which adds meaning to the purchase.
  • Buying directly from the maker ensures more of your money supports the local family.

What NOT to Expect

Lao Chai’s market is small and informal compared to Sapa town’s main market — don’t expect a wide variety of souvenirs or fixed pricing; it’s best approached as an authentic, low-key shopping experience rather than a full retail stop.

What can I buy in Lao Chai village? Indigo-dyed textiles, hand embroidery, silver jewelry, woven baskets, and hemp products are commonly available.

Is bargaining expected in Lao Chai’s market? Yes, but it should be done respectfully — a friendly negotiation rather than aggressive haggling.

Should I buy handicrafts in Lao Chai or Sapa town? Buying directly from artisans in Lao Chai typically ensures more of your money supports the local family rather than a middleman.

Do sellers in Lao Chai accept cards or only cash? Cash is standard, and small bills are recommended since change for large notes can be limited.

Is Lao Chai’s market as large as Sapa town’s market? No, it’s smaller and more informal — best approached as an authentic experience rather than a major shopping destination.
